I will be using power point for a lecture where the images will be projected onto a rather large screen. what dpi resolution should I use for high quality. thanks

If the output resolution is 1024x768, 102.4 dpi. Many
projectors/scan converters get unstable over 1024x768, but
if an unusually large screen is being used, they may have
the equipment to handle a larger output (like 1600x1200),
in which case you can go to 160 dpi. Best bet is to find
out what resolution the computers should be set at for the
lecture.
